hello campers
Ok question,
I've got one of those project 2000 electric beds , it works fine but my wife who's not in the best of health cannot access it easily re the bed needs to come down another 150 mm ie I need to reset bottom limit .
The manual is full of info but adjusting says ( take to a specialist) mm ! Dealer is 200 miles away so not doing that , I don't want to try to adjust in case it all goes west,
I seem to remember and there is a ( secret button )between the up/down buttons on the bed panel but that's as far as I remember

Hi Spidey - don't think this will help much but found general Chausson 2014 manual http://www.chausson-camping-cars.fr/wp-content/uploads/MANUEL-Chausson-2014-Anglais.pdf & on page 52
"1) Intermediate:
- Bed lowered in two stages halfway «automatically» simply
by pressing the control button. In this intermediate position
it is of course possible to reach the bed via a ladder as well
as in the lower position using the dining table.
2) Low:
The low position can be accessed from the intermediate
position by:
- Keeping your finger on the control button until the
travel end stop. This position enables access to the bed
without a ladder, but it is no longer possible to use the
dinette area for another bed. The return to day-time
position (bed in the roof) takes place in 3 phases, the
first two being automatic simply by pressing the control
button and the final one, until the engine stops, by
pressing constantly on the control button. This is contrary
to the maneuver for descending the bed.
NB : Maximum allowed mass on the moveable bed
is: electrically controlled central bed = 140cm:
230 kg and manually controlled central bed = 120cm:
150 kg. A lever to activate the system in case of total
electrical failure is supplied with the bed."

Raise the bed to its maximum height to confirm this the up and down arrows will flash if it activates the stop switch.
Press and hold the the hidden button between the up and down buttons and the up switch for about 7 seconds the spanner led will light.
Lower the bed to the first required stop height and press the hidden button and the down button the up and down arrows will flash to confirm.
You can record 2 more heights and then the controller automatically comes out of programming mode.
